The Ragged Island microgrid has been viewed as a proven standard model for rapid development of similar facilities worldwide. The microgrid has a solar capacity of 402 kWp. The project includes design, procurement, installation and a year’s operation of a solar-battery microgrid coupled with the existing diesel plant. The microgrid construction was undertaken by Tugliq Energy and its construction partner Salt Energy. This microgrid offers protection from natural disasters and fuel price changes. After the passage of hurricane Irma, the Bahamas Power and Light Company ( BPL) developed a project to implement a Ragged Island microgrid that includes renewable energy. Ragged Island's electricity was originally provided using diesel generators. Ragged Island is an out island in The Bahamas archipelago. By 2018 utilities were seeking a closer relationship with homeowners whose home storage batteries could help balance grid load and thus reduce the need for new conventional power plants. Sellers of home storage batteries partnered with public utilities. In 2016 Greentech Media reported that Australian utilities were starting to offer home battery upgrades as a way to participate in a growing home battery storage market. Various public utilities, related organizations and governments have started or considered programs offering home energy upgrades from public utilities.
